What is RTP and Why It Matters
Return to Player (RTP) is one of the most important concepts every slot enthusiast should understand. This percentage represents the average amount of money a slot machine returns to players over thousands of spins. For example, a slot with 96% RTP theoretically returns $96 for every $100 wagered.

Comparing RTPs Across Different Slots
Not all slots are created equal. Classic three-reel machines might offer 90-92% RTP, while modern video slots frequently feature 94-97% returns. Progressive jackpot slots sometimes run lower RTPs but offer life-changing prize pools that attract millions of players worldwide.
